Transaction 85ad620e8679c52af63f762fbbf4447b68b7558427f2f2b27f52d8a87bb72fb4

1 Input
2 Outputs
  • 85ad620e8679c52af63f762fbbf4447b68b7558427f2f2b27f52d8a87bb72fb4:0
  • value  10000000
    address  35vCv3R5pNMDRvgF4JMBP3mXXapMMPttcy
  • 85ad620e8679c52af63f762fbbf4447b68b7558427f2f2b27f52d8a87bb72fb4:1
  • value  25059067
    address  bc1qt74s8epxar4tu927d4ca9yf2ushqsvpmn00lkn